I’ve wondered if this really is the right time for David Archuleta to be releasing a holiday cd, but hey, he does say in the liner notes that he wanted to do the album so he could share his love of Christmas (and as a gift for his fans), so (as a fellow Christmas-lover) who am I to complain? It would be pretty stating the obvious to say that David has the perfect voice for the traditional Christmas hymns – it’s that choir boy purity / bell-like clarity of his voice coupled with his rich and warm tone.

I don’t think anyone will be surprised when I say that the stand-outs on this CD for me are ‘Ave Maria‘, ‘O Holy Night‘, ‘Silent Night‘ and ‘What Child Is This‘ which David sings with heartfelt and genuine conviction. In particular, I have to emphasize how much I love his ‘Ave Maria‘ (!!!) – I’ve gotten so used to it being sung with operatic embellishments, it’s a breath of fresh air to have it sung simply and reverently, while still eliciting that strong emotional reaction that this beautiful song inspires.

I was also pleasantly surprised with how much I liked ‘Pat-A-Pan‘ (such a fun, upbeat song! And it’s French!) and ‘Riu Riu Chiu‘ (it has this wistful & yearning quality that I like, although I have no idea what the song’s Spanish lyrics are about!). Both are new-to-me Christmas songs (in a foreign language) that are excellent additions to my old favorites. So, thank you David for these two.

Jive hasn’t scrimped on production for this cd, and I enjoyed the accompanying orchestral instrumentation / background choir, (very evident on such songs as ‘Joy to the World‘, ‘Angels We Have Heard on High‘, ‘O Come All Ye Faithful‘) but above all that, it is David’s voice that is the major selling point of this album.

Okay, I’ve talked up all the positives for this album, but there are some songs I’ll be skipping in this album and unfortunately, it includes the only original song in the album. I seriously did give ‘Melodies of Christmas‘ a fair shake by listening several times (since David co-wrote it), but it just doesn’t measure up well – lyrically or melody. I don’t hate it, and it’ll probably grow on me eventually, but if I were buying just singles, I wouldn’t really get this song. (But at least, David will receive bigger royalties from this song since he did co-write it). I do get what David was going for – hell, it’s in the title – tying up all the Christmas melodies in one neat little bow.

I’ll also be skipping over ‘Have Yourself A Merry Little Christmas‘ and ‘I’ll Be Home for Christmas‘. Just not enjoying these songs like the traditional ones. Charice Pempengco does a great job on the duet with David, but for some strange reason, I’ve never liked this song. Like ever. I would have preferred to have David sing ‘Mary Did You Know’ or ‘Grown Up Christmas Wish’ instead, if Jive wanted to add “newer” (relatively speaking) songs to the album. Or maybe, they could have added more foreign language Christmas songs? (** speaking of, anyone out there with foreign language Christmas carol recommendations?) But I will add that I’m very thankful that David/Jive did not add any ‘novelty’ songs in this cd, especially since his voice would’ve been totally wasted on them.
